CVE-2019-5773: Insufficient data validation in IndexedDB

First published: Mon Dec 24 2018(Updated: )

An insufficient data validation flaw was found in the IndexedDB component of the Chromium browser. Frequently Asked Questions

  • What is the severity of CVE-2019-5773?

    CVE-2019-5773 has a high severity due to an insufficient data validation flaw in the Chromium browser's IndexedDB component.

  • How do I fix CVE-2019-5773?

    To fix CVE-2019-5773, update to the latest version of the Chromium browser or Google Chrome as specified in the security advisories.

  • Which versions are affected by CVE-2019-5773?

    CVE-2019-5773 affects versions of Chromium and Google Chrome prior to 72.0.3626.81.

  • What products are impacted by CVE-2019-5773?

    CVE-2019-5773 impacts multiple products including Chromium browser, Google Chrome, and any distributions relying on these applications.

  • Is CVE-2019-5773 exploitable remotely?

    Yes, CVE-2019-5773 can be potentially exploited remotely due to its presence in web applications using the affected browsers.
